Envestnet Asset Management Inc. decreased its holdings in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age, Inc. (NYSE:NGVC – Free Report) by 40.2%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 8,287 shares of the specialty retailer’s stock after selling 5,564 shares during the quarter. Envestnet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age were worth $329,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E:NGVC opened at $49.13 on Wednesday. The company has a current ratio of 0.96, a quick ratio of 0.15 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.28.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age, Inc. has a 1-year low of $17.65 and a 1-year high of $52.69. The stock has a market capitalization of $1.13 billion, a P/E ratio of 31.29 and a beta of 1.62. The business has a 50-day moving average price of $42.95 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$41.02.
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age (NYSE:NGVC –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 6th. The specialty retailer reported $0.43 earnings per share for the quarter.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age had a net margin of 2.84% and a return on equity of 21.12%. Equities analysts predict that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age, Inc. will post 1.61 earnings per share for the current year.
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age Dividend Announcement
The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, March 19th. Stockholders of record on Monday, March 3rd were given a $0.12 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Monday, March 3rd. This represents a $0.48 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.98%.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age’s dividend payout ratio is currently 30.57%.
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age Company Profile
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, retails natural and organic groceries, and dietary supplements in the United States. The company’s stores offer natural and organic grocery products, such as organic produce; private label repackaged bulk products, including dried fruits, nuts, grains, granolas, teas, herbs, and spices, as well as peanut and almond butters; private label products comprising grocery staples, household products, bulk foods, and vitamins and dietary supplements, as well as organic eggs, organic flavored coffee, and organic mustard; dry, frozen, and canned groceries; meat and seafood products; dairy products, dairy substitutes, and eggs; prepared foods; bread and baked products; beverages; and beer, wine, and hard cider products.
